At least for now here is a workaround: 1) when booting, enter grub startup menu 2) enter 'e' to edit command before upstart 3) delete the line saying "gfxmode $linux_gfx_mode" 4) hit CTRL-x to start boot Another thing that works (more permanently) is to add a line GRUB_GFXPAYLOAD_LINUX=text to /etc/default/grub as described in the manual page for update-grub-gfxpayload and run `sudo update-grub` after that.
